#1cf935 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1cf935 is composed of 11% red, 97.6%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.7%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 126.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 54.3%. #1cf935 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ff6a with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

● #1cf935 color description : Vivid lime green.
The hexadecimal color #1cf935 has RGB values of R:28, G:249,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 1898805.
